@vuejs_ru

Страница 1796 из 3900
Rafael
24.12.2017
18:28:13
Всем привет. А есть ли отдельный чатик с резюме фронтендеров, работающих с Вью?)
нет, есть общий чат для поиска работы фронтам @javascript_jobs

Роман
24.12.2017
18:29:05
ещё вопрос, более приближенный к земле есть компонент кнопки, простой как тяпка, нужен везде. Я раньше просто кидал событие по клику. правильно ли я понимаю, что если я решу использовать стор, то у меня 2 пути, чтобы не иметь компонента кнопки под каждое действие: 1. всё так же кидать событие, а родительский компонент пусть сам общается со стором 2. через пропсы запихивать в кнопку мутатор нужно пнуть верно? какой путь более идеологически верный?

MVP
24.12.2017
18:31:47
всем привет! если не сложно - напишите какого крутого frontend-деятеля работающего с vue которого надо позвать на конференцию. (Sarah Drasner, Evan, братья Chopin и тп - не считается)

Google
Sunlive
24.12.2017
19:09:33
Для es/ts lint использую от airbnb
да я тож для джса юзал их конфиг, но чет ток щас удалось прикрутить линтинг к тс файлам

Леха
24.12.2017
19:13:38
Здравствуйте. Крутится Node.js Rest API, перед ним Nginx. Не могу с локалхоста достучаться до VPS. Response to preflight request doesn't pass access control check: No 'Access-Control-Allow-Origin' header is present on the requested resource. Origin 'http://localhost:8080' is therefore not allowed access. Вот такой конфиг location ~ ^/api/(.*)/?$ { add_header 'Access-Control-Allow-Origin' $http_origin; expires off; if ($request_method = 'OPTIONS') { # Tell client that this pre-flight info is valid for 20 days add_header 'Access-Control-Max-Age' 1728000; add_header 'Content-Type' 'text/plain charset=UTF-8'; add_header 'Content-Length' 0; return 204; } add_header 'Access-Control-Allow-Methods' $access_control_allow_methods always; add_header 'Access-Control-Allow-Headers' $access_control_allow_headers always; add_header 'Access-Control-Allow-Credentials' 'true' always; # required to be able to read Authorization header in frontend add_header 'Access-Control-Expose-Headers' $access_control_expose_headers always; proxy_pass http://vuejobs_api$request_uri; } При этом Advanced REST Client нормально общается. Ошмбка в браузере, при использовании axios.

Может сталкивался кто? Просто я хз что еще надо

Леха
24.12.2017
19:15:41
Включен на сервере

Kamil
24.12.2017
19:18:27
Я не могу сказать что это крутые ребята, но я просто даже не знаю кого ещё

Если мы не берём в расчет членов самой команды

Dmitriy
24.12.2017
19:59:23
Может сталкивался кто? Просто я хз что еще надо
С холокоста не получится без этой либы, проверено, и не важно что на сервере включено

Леха
24.12.2017
20:00:14
Что не получится без чего? В Node.js приложении на VPS cors() включен.

Google
Dmitriy
24.12.2017
20:01:20
Что не получится без чего? В Node.js приложении на VPS cors() включен.
Извини, тема про вуй, не думал и на сервере жеэс. Тогда проблема скорее всего в твоем провайдер, была такая проблемакогда ртк пользовался. никак не мог с холокоста обращаться к урлам на серверах (по домену).

С другой стороны, может быть все что угодно )))

Леха
24.12.2017
20:04:12
Беда в том, что к рабочему проекту (бэк на Ruby) доступ есть. А свое развернул и вот такая вот борода :(

Dmitriy
24.12.2017
20:05:59
Леха
24.12.2017
20:06:16
Nginx

Dmitriy
24.12.2017
20:06:32
А у него включен cors?

Леха
24.12.2017
20:06:36
Та я в замешательстве. Запрос только в браузере не работает, через axios

Из Rest Client все гуд

Dmitriy
24.12.2017
20:06:57
Так все правильно )))

Полости админа включить cors в nginx

Леха
24.12.2017
20:07:50
По прямой ссылке захожу - все ОК

Добавляю в GET токен и перехожу по ссылке - все норм

Dmitriy
24.12.2017
20:08:37
Да это не важно, поверь, настройте cors в nginx, и все заработает

Леха
24.12.2017
20:14:07
Ну так а как настроить? Запрос через axios - ERROR Запрос через Advanced REST Client - OK

Куда еще думать?

Dmitriy
24.12.2017
20:15:24
Я же говорю, включи cors на стороне nginx

И все заработает

Блин, спать пора, пьяный уже. Если не получится, пиши, завтра помогу.

Леха
24.12.2017
20:17:28
Я же говорю, включи cors на стороне nginx
Он включен. У меня же Advanced REST Client работает с локалхоста как-то

Google
Dmitriy
24.12.2017
20:19:54
Он включен. У меня же Advanced REST Client работает с локалхоста как-то
Мужик, маны в помощь, ARC посылает иные заголовки, нежели твой клиент, копай в сторону настроек nginx

И, кстати, ARC, работает не с холокоста, он шлет что-то другое, если я не ошибаюсь, как и постман

Леха
24.12.2017
20:32:46
И, кстати, ARC, работает не с холокоста, он шлет что-то другое, если я не ошибаюсь, как и постман
Я был почти уверен, что где-то сломался axios. Спасибо, друг, что натолкнул на мысль, что ARC через промежуточный сервер шлет запросы. У меня в Nginx была ошибка.

Dmitriy
24.12.2017
20:33:48
)

Rafael
24.12.2017
20:59:14
http://pixeljets.com/blog/vue-js-vs-react-what-to-expect-in-2018/

?
24.12.2017
21:43:39
>vs

Ivan
25.12.2017
04:30:42
Ребят, я уже спрашивал, но забыл что ответили) У меня есть поиск, который берёт value из инпута, дергает апишку и выводит список по совпадениям, так вот, как можно сделать, что бы не дёргать апишку на каждый ввод пользователя. Не знаю что гуглить даже

Ivan
25.12.2017
04:34:15
да

слишком я многословен)

★nton
25.12.2017
04:34:51
Гугли debounce :)

zinge
25.12.2017
04:40:32
да
В официальной доке по vue есть готовый пример кстати

Serge
25.12.2017
06:05:35
привет. Есть у кого любые мысли, как запилить некий проектировщик интерфейса. Ну т.е. накидываешь и драг`н`дропишь всякие разные визуальные элементы, двигаешь, меняешь размеры\местами, а оно на основании этого генерит файл с vue template. Может есть примеры подобных задач где нибудь поглядеть или чего погуглить скажите...

по аналогии, как в дельфях формы, если кто писал на них раньше...

Souren
25.12.2017
06:17:22
но наверняка не драг-н-дропом

Dmitry
25.12.2017
06:18:35
Нет. С этим придется самому поработать

Serge
25.12.2017
06:21:07
печальбеда

Google
Souren
25.12.2017
06:22:05
я для бутстрапа видел такие драг-н-дроп редакторы, если форма из простых элементов будет состоять, можно в таком редакторе сделать, а потом вместо инпутов свои компоненты поставить.

Souren
25.12.2017
06:24:09
а как поискать ? где посмотреть ?
https://bootstrapbay.com/blog/bootstrap-editors/

Serge
25.12.2017
06:25:28
вооо, чёта типа такого хочется запилить https://jetstrap.com/demo

Anton
25.12.2017
06:46:20
Данные из Vuex читают только компоненты контейнеры, остальные компоненты должны получать данные через v-bind от компонентов контейнеров.
Чем компонент-контейнер отличается от компонента-неконтейнера? И может ли быть контейнер в контейнере?

Danil
25.12.2017
06:56:02
Добрый день! Столкнулся с проблемой при использовании vuetify.js. Проблема заключается в том, что при клике на любой чекбокс выделяются все чекбоксы. https://codepen.io/DanilChugaev/pen/veYrKw?editors=1010 вот тут все работает, потому что данные (items, headers) уже присутствуют в data но если эти данные получать откуда то, при клике на любой чекбокс выделяются все чекбоксы. this.getDataFromApi() //тут получаю данные .then(data => { //обнуляю массивы как сказано в документации this.headers.splice(0) this.items.splice(0) //добавляю данные data.headers.forEach((item, i) => { this.headers.push(item) }) data.items.forEach((item, i) => { this.items.push(item) }) }) Если я у себя просто вставляю данные сразу в data() то все работает. долго уже не могу решить проблему, подскажите пожалуйста что делать

DimenSi
25.12.2017
06:58:40
Чем компонент-контейнер отличается от компонента-неконтейнера? И может ли быть контейнер в контейнере?
Из реакта пришла практика умных контейнеров и глупых компонентов. Умных контейнер содержит в себе работу с апи или со стором, а глупые компоненты имеют связь только с контейнерами и общаются исключительно с ним.

И да, контейнер может быть вложен в другой контейнер.

Anton
25.12.2017
06:59:59
А причем тут Реакт?:)

DimenSi
25.12.2017
07:01:11
Ты шутишь? Ты сам просил, что это. Я объяснил.

Из реакта пришел паттерн. Точней не из реакта, а из редакса.

Anton
25.12.2017
07:06:39
Мой последний вопрос был про причинно-следственную связь Реакта и паттерна работы со стейтом.

Ну, я думаю, мы друг друга поняли

Danil
25.12.2017
07:11:35
item-key="name"

как и в документации к vuetify

Serge
25.12.2017
07:13:19
как и в документации к vuetify
ну а в this.items поле "name" присутствует ?

и оно уникально должно быть

Google
Danil
25.12.2017
07:15:22
ну а в this.items поле "name" присутствует ?
Огромнейшее спасибо! я уже все перерыл а вот на item-key я даже внимание не обратил, просто спас ?

Т
25.12.2017
09:33:03
всем привет, а есть owl sync (овл каруселька синхронизированная) на vue.js а не на jquery?

Т
25.12.2017
10:42:41
Vue awesome
в принципе через data dots решил делать. но всё равно спасибо большое

Evgeniy
25.12.2017
10:43:31
Там есть много готовых элементов в том числе и каруселька

Alex
25.12.2017
11:39:56
Всем привет. Вопрос скорее по js, но как без говнокода сделать при выборе "Все" сброс фильтра? https://jsfiddle.net/hqu90w7q/

Niko
25.12.2017
11:45:50
Я, конечно, может уже слегка невменяем, но что значит сброс фильтра...?) Чтобы показывались и активные и неактивные,при выборе "все"?

Владимир
25.12.2017
11:46:51
Alex
25.12.2017
11:51:32
@c01nd01r Владимир благодарю!

Oleh
25.12.2017
12:16:46
Всем привет! Подскажите как грамотно разбивать в vuex например хранилище (state) на несколько разных фалов? export default { test: require('./state/test') } В таком случае мне приходится обращаться через .default если я в файле test.js прописываю export default {}. this.$store.state.test.default.some_test_item;

Страница 1796 из 3900